Program Coordinator
4 weeks ago
Position DetailsJob Title: Program Coordinator - InternLocation: Vancouver/Toronto, Canada Job SummaryThe Program Coordinator provides overall assistance to the Delivery leadership team and supports the daily operational activities, process enhancements, and the governance of Intellect's Digital Engagement Platform rollout program.ResponsibilitiesAssist in coordinating and tracking ongoing projects within the Delivery team, ensuring timelines, deliverables and updates are accurately maintained.Support the preparation and maintenance of project documentation, reports and dashboards in collaboration with Project Managers and team leads.Help gather and analyze project data for reporting on milestones, risks and progress updates.Contribute to maintaining project and portfolio management tools (Tracking sheets, dashboards, or internal systems) to ensure data accuracy and consistency.Assist with the organization of project meetings, preparing agendas, capturing meeting notes and following up on action items.Support the preparation of communication materials, presentations and project summaries for leadership or stakeholder updates.Collaborate with cross functional teams to support alignment on ongoing initiatives and project deliverables.Assist in identifying process improvement opportunities and documenting best practices across projects.Maintain organized project files, libraries and templates to support team efficiency and knowledge sharing.Provide general administrative and coordination support to the Delivery Management teams as required.QualificationsCurrently pursuing or recently completed a post-secondary diploma or degree in Business Administration, Project Management or a related field.Strong interest in project coordination, process improvement and supporting team operations.Basic experience or coursework using Google Suite applications.Strong organizational and time management skills, with the ability to handle multiple priorities.Details oriented, proactive and eager to learn in a fast paced environment.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to work collaboratively across teams.Demonstrated ability to work independently and take initiative while following established guidelines and processes.
